How to check for abnormal vaginal discharge

How to check for abnormal vaginal discharge

Abnormal vaginal discharge can be checked through gynecological examination, routine vaginal discharge examination and vaginal discharge culture. The specific choice should be determined according to symptoms and doctor's advice. Abnormal vaginal discharge may be caused by infection, hormonal changes or diseases. Timely examination can help to identify the cause and take targeted treatment.

1. Gynecological examination

Gynecological examination is the basic examination method for abnormal vaginal discharge. The doctor observes the condition of the vulva, vagina and cervix with the naked eye to determine whether there is inflammation, ulcers or other abnormalities. During the examination, the doctor will use a vaginal dilator to observe the color, texture and smell of the vaginal discharge to preliminarily determine whether there is infection or other problems. Gynecological examination is non-invasive and quick, and is suitable as a preliminary screening method.

2. Routine examination of leucorrhea

Routine examination of leucorrhea is to observe the cells, bacteria and fungi in leucorrhea under a microscope to determine whether there is pathogen infection. The examination items include pH value, cleanliness, white blood cell count, fungi and trichomonas. This examination can determine whether there are common infections such as bacterial vaginitis, candidal vaginitis or trichomonas vaginitis. Routine examination of leucorrhea is simple to operate and the results are fast. It is a common method for diagnosing abnormal leucorrhea.

3. Vaginal secretion culture

If routine examination of vaginal discharge does not reveal the cause, your doctor may recommend a vaginal discharge culture. By placing a sample of discharge in a culture medium and observing the growth of pathogens, the type of infection can be more accurately determined, especially for some rare or drug-resistant strains. Culture results usually take a few days, but can provide a more accurate basis for treatment.

Abnormal vaginal discharge may be caused by a variety of reasons, including bacterial infection, fungal infection, Trichomonas infection, changes in hormone levels, or cervical disease. The treatment method should be selected according to the specific cause. For example, bacterial vaginitis can be treated with metronidazole or clindamycin; candidal vaginitis is often treated with fluconazole or clotrimazole; and Trichomonas vaginitis requires metronidazole or tinidazole. Maintaining good personal hygiene habits, avoiding excessive cleaning, and using gentle care products can also help prevent abnormal vaginal discharge.

Abnormal vaginal discharge is a common health problem for women. Timely examination can help identify the cause and take targeted treatment. Through gynecological examination, routine vaginal discharge examination and vaginal secretion culture, the problem can be accurately diagnosed. In terms of treatment, it is necessary to choose appropriate drugs according to the type of infection, and pay attention to personal hygiene and lifestyle adjustments. If symptoms persist or worsen, you should seek medical attention in time to avoid delaying the condition.
